Kernel+LibC: Add MAP_RANDOMIZED flag for sys$mmap()
This can be used to request random VM placement instead of the highly predictable regular mmap(nullptr, ...) VM allocation strategy. It will soon be used to implement ASLR in the dynamic loader. :^)
